Description
Dog Breed: Unknown breed / mixed. Adoptable in: MA, RI, NH, CT, and VT Good with dogs: Yes Good with cats: Unknown, likely yes Good with kids: Yes, dog savvy children Crate trained: Yes House Trained: Yes Janine is a sweet, easygoing girl with effortless charm that makes her fit right into any home. She is a medium energy girl who loves running and playing chase with her dog friends outdoors and then settles immediately once she comes back inside. She would be a wonderful fit for just about any home looking for a laid-back, low-drama companion. Janine lives happily in a multi-dog foster home with residents and fosters ranging from five to seventy-five pounds without any issues. She would do great with or without a canine sibling. She has not been around cats but her sweet and easygoing nature suggests she would likely do fine with proper introductions. She would do best with dog-savvy kids who can provide some structure and boundaries around their initial interactions. Janine is a smart, well-mannered girl with no bad habits and not a single bark to report. She is fully crate trained and settles in throughout the day and overnight without any issues. She is fully house trained on a consistent daily routine. She is a great car riding buddy and walks well on leash, occasionally pulling but overall doing great on her outings. This sweet, easygoing girl is ready to say goodbye to shelter life for good and settle into a forever home that will love her as much as she will love them. Could Janine be the one for you? Breed overview
Overview:
A mongrel, mutt, or mixed-breed dog, is a dog that is not the result of breeding within an existing breed or to modify or create a breed and belongs to no breed. In the United States, the term "mixed-breed" is a favored synonym over "mongrel" among many who wish to avoid negative connotations associated with the latter term. The implication that such dogs must be a mix of defined breeds may stem from an inverted understanding of the origins of dog breeds. Pure breeds have been, for the most part, artificially created from random-bred populations by human selective breeding with the purpose of enhancing desired physical, behavioral, or temperamental characteristics. Dogs that are not purebred are not necessarily a mix of such defined breeds. Therefore, among experts and fans of such dogs, "Mongrel" is still the preferred term.
